    $$$$$ paint job

    What is the cost of a GOOD paint job ( two stage) or ( lacquer) not a museum piece or back yard job?? C1 or C2

        Re: $$$$$ paint job

        Roy-----

        For a FACTORY-TYPE paint job, I would say the cost would be in the $7,000 to $10,000 range.
